Craig, one other thing to check is that the Qlikocx.ocx and the Qvp.dll file versions match, those are located by default in the following directories:
C:\Program Files (x86)\QlikView\QvPlugin
C:\Program Files (x86)\QlikView\QvProtocol
Generally, mismatches account for most of these types of issues, so definitely check that, if things are good, then I would open a support case, so we can look into things in more detail with you and the customer.
